The Real Cost of Manual RPM Sensor Verification
Manual verification of rotary slitter blade RPM sensors is a time-consuming and error-prone process that often leads to production inefficiencies. This manual approach requires highly skilled technicians to physically inspect the sensors, verify their readings against manufacturer specifications, and ensure proper synchronization with the machine's operational speed.
The reliance on human intervention introduces significant variability in the verification process, leading to potential discrepancies between actual RPM values and expected performance levels. These inconsistencies can result in prolonged equipment downtime, costly rework, and reduced overall equipment effectiveness (OEE). Moreover, the time-consuming nature of manual inspections diverts valuable resources away from high-value tasks like process optimization or preventive maintenance planning, ultimately affecting the competitiveness of industrial operations.
